- U.S. GOVERNMENT General Services Administration (GSA) seeks to lease the following space: State: Pennsylvania City: Frackville Delineated Area: North: From the intersection of S Hoffman Boulevard and PA Road 54/Centre Street (the Point of Beginning), travel east on PA Road 54 to the intersection with Tuscarora Mountain Drive. East: Go south on Tuscarora Mountain Drive/Catawissa Street to PA Route 209. South: Travel southwest on PA Route 209 to PA Road 901 (Pottsville Minersville Highway). Continue northwest on PA Road 901 and Sunbury Road to the intersection with Taylorsville Road. West: Travel east on Taylorsville Road to Airport Road and then Biddle Street. Turn northwest into McKnight Street and continue on to Gordon Road. Travel north on Gordon Road/Nater Street to S Hoffman Boulevard (PA Road 61). Continue north on S Hoffman Boulevard to PA Road 54 (Centre Street), the Point of Beginning. Minimum Sq. Ft. (ABOA): 4,646 ABOA SF Maximum Sq. Ft. (ABOA): 4,646 ABOA SF Space Type: Office Parking Spaces (Total): Forty Seven (47) Total Parking Spaces Parking Spaces (Surface): Forty Seven (47) Surface Spaces Parking Spaces (Structured): Zero (0) Structured Parking Spaces Parking Spaces (Reserved): Twenty One (21) Reserved Parking Spaces Full Term: Five (5) Years Firm Term: One (1) Year Option Term: None Additional Requirements: The Government shall have access to the building 24 hours a day, 7 days a week. Space must be contiguous on one floor. If offered space is above the first floor, a freight elevator is required. Interested parties must provide the name of the building, address, location of available space, rentable square feet offered, and contact information of authorized representative. All interested parties must either submit evidence of ownership or written authorization to represent the owner(s). Any submissions received without documentation of ownership and/or written authorization to represent the owner(s) will not be considered until such time the documentation has been received, which must also be submitted prior to the Expression of Interests Due Date. In cases where an agent is representing multiple ownership entities, broker must provide written acknowledgement / permission to represent multiple interested parties for the same submission. Reference project number: 3PA0347 Offered space must meet Government requirements for fire safety, accessibility, seismic, and sustainability standards per the terms of the Lease. A fully serviced lease is required. Offered space shall not be in the 0.2-percent-annual chance floodplain (formerly referred to as �500-Year� floodplain). Entities are advised to familiarize themselves with the telecommunications prohibitions outlined under Section 889 of the FY19 National Defense Authorization Act (NDAA), as implemented by the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R). For more information, visit: https://acquisition.gov/FAR-Case-2019-009/889_Part_B. The U.S. Government currently occupies office and related space in a building under a lease in Frackville, PA, that will be expiring. The Government is considering alternative space if economically advantageous. In making this determination, the Government will consider, among other things, the availability of alternative space that potentially can satisfy the Government�s requirements, as well as costs likely to be incurred through relocating, such as physical move costs, replication of tenant improvements and telecommunication infrastructure, and non-productive agency downtime. At this time, the Government is only considering existing buildings, and will not consider new construction options.
